Military Siege Electoral Commission As Bobiwine Meets Justice Byabakama Over Brutality

Uganda Police and military deployed heavily around Kampala city as National Unity Platform (NUP) presidential Candidate Kyagulanyi Ssentamu Robert was meeting Electoral Commission Chairman Justice Simon Byabakama and his team.

The meeting came after Bobiwine suspended presidential campaigns citing excessive security brutality against his supporters.

Bobi Wine’s official car was destroyed when he approached Jinja town. His vehicle was riddled with bullets that forced his tire to puncture, as the police held him from what one of the officers described as an “unmarked” route to the assembly.

It occurred a few minutes after several injured people were recorded in Kayunga district where even Bobi’s immediate police escort, ASP Kato, was shot in the eye, and another person known as Daniel Oyerwot aka Dan Magic producer. The duo was urgently transported to Mulago Hospital when we filed this report.

After receiving complaints from NUP,  Electoral Commission  responded positively to Bobi Wine’s request to hold a meeting with the EC chairman over what he termed an imbalanced campaign ground.

Kyagulanyi accompanied  by a five-person team presented their grievances to EC team which promised to work on their issues.EC also advised NUP leadership to avoid flouting Covid-19 guidelines by holding processions which lead to the spread of the deadly disease.

Kampala metropolitan police spokesperson Patrick Onyango assured Kampalans that the city was already secured, safe and encouraged people to continue their daily business activities with out any fear.
